time.innerhtml
时间: 2023-07-10 08:10:29 浏览: 38
这是一个 JavaScript 代码片段,它会将当前时间的字符串表示插入到 HTML 页面中具有 "time" ID 的元素中。具体代码如下:
```javascript
document.getElementById("time").innerHTML = new Date().toLocaleString();
```
请注意,这段代码只有在 HTML 页面中含有 ID 为 "time" 的元素时才能正常运行。
相关问题
</script> <button class="start">开始</button> <button class="stop">暂停</button> <button class="end">结束</button> <h1 class="time">10:9</h1> <script> //定义按钮 let start = document.querySelector('.start') let stop = document.querySelector('.stop') let end = document.querySelector('.end') let time = document.querySelector('.time') let seconds = 0 let ms = 0 time.innerHTML = `${seconds}:${ms}` let timer = null // 开启计时器 start.onclick = function () { // 开始的时候删掉之前的计时器并重新开启一个计时器 防止多次开启计时器越来越快的情况 clearInterval(timer) timer = setInterval(() => { // 设置进制 if (ms === 9) { seconds++ ms = 0 } ms++ time.innerHTML = `${seconds}:${ms}` }, 100) } // 暂停计时器 stop.onclick = function () { clearInterval(timer) } // 结束计时器 end.onclick = function () { seconds = 0 ms = 0 time.innerHTML = `${seconds}:${ms}` } </script>
这是一段使用 JavaScript 实现计时器功能的代码。代码中,通过 document.querySelector() 方法获取了三个按钮和一个显示时间的元素,并初始化了秒数和毫秒数为 0。然后定义了一个 timer 变量用于存储计时器实例,并且给开始按钮添加了点击事件,点击开始按钮会清除之前的计时器,并重新开启一个计时器,每 100 毫秒增加一次毫秒数,当毫秒数达到 9 时,将秒数增加一,毫秒数归零,最后更新显示时间。给暂停按钮添加了点击事件,点击暂停按钮会清除计时器。给结束按钮添加了点击事件,点击结束按钮会将秒数和毫秒数重置为 0,并更新显示时间。
document.getElementById('time').innerHTML = dateTime;如何在HTML中用文本框显示
你可以使用以下代码在 HTML 中创建一个文本框,并将其显示当前日期和时间:
```
<input type="text" id="timeBox">
<script>
var dateTime = new Date().toLocaleString();
document.getElementById('timeBox').value = dateTime;
</script>
```
这将创建一个类型为文本的输入框,并使用 JavaScript 将当前日期和时间设置为其值。